How to Choose the Right Auto Parts Wholesaler
Shops and fleet operators should evaluate wholesalers on parts availability, fit accuracy, delivery speed, and pricing. A supplier that consistently delivers the correct part on the first try saves enormous time and protects a shop's reputation with its own customers. Buyers should also consider the balance of OE and aftermarket options, since offering choices helps serve a wider range of budgets.
Relationships matter in this industry. A responsive account representative who understands a shop's typical needs can prioritize urgent orders, suggest alternatives when items are backordered, and provide better terms as volume grows. Building trust with a dependable wholesaler is one of the smartest investments a repair business can make.
Planning a Successful Louisville Supplier Relationship
Before committing to any of these auto parts wholesalers, create a written list of must-have specifications, estimated monthly volume, acceptable lead times, and budget limits. This turns an introductory conversation into a useful business discussion and makes competing quotes easier to compare. Louisville buyers should also ask how delivery schedules change during severe weather, holiday peaks, major local events, or seasonal demand. A supplier with a realistic contingency plan can be more valuable than one offering the lowest initial quote.
Request clear details about minimum orders, payment terms, damaged-goods procedures, warranties, and any charges that may not appear in the unit price. Freight, handling, rush service, and restocking costs can materially change the final value of an order. When possible, inspect samples or place a controlled first order before shifting a large share of purchasing. Track accuracy, condition, timeliness, and communication so the decision rests on measurable performance rather than promises.
Why Local and Regional Sourcing Matters
Working with suppliers serving Louisville can shorten replenishment cycles and make problem solving more direct. Local knowledge is particularly useful when demand is affected by the city's hospitality calendar, construction activity, school schedules, manufacturing cycles, and the needs of businesses on both sides of the Ohio River. Regional sourcing can also reduce freight exposure and make smaller, more frequent orders practical, helping buyers carry less excess inventory.
That does not mean location should outweigh quality or value. The strongest purchasing strategy compares total landed cost, dependable availability, service, and product suitability. Many businesses benefit from naming one primary supplier and maintaining a qualified secondary source for critical items. Regular performance reviews, honest forecasts, and prompt communication help both parties plan capacity and resolve issues before they disrupt customers.
